dc.description.abstractThe Area 55 project feasibility studies mentioned in last year's report; which include archaeological, hydrogeological, metallurgical and geotechnical works, was put on hold during the year due to the company shifting its focus from oxide targets to sulphide targets. This work has not been cancelled but put on hold. There are no completed final reports from this work although the associated expenditure so far is summarised in the expenditure statement of this report. As a result of this shift a broad geophysical program had just finished during compilation of this report. Costs for the work have been incurred although no reportable data has been received yet. Historical geophysical surveys were reprocessed and investigated in the lead up to this work. This survey consisted of a detailed heli-borne electromagnetic program (AEM), detailed infill gravity program and a detailed airborne magnetic survey. AEM flight lines were oriented both north south and east west across ERL 148 at 100m line spacings. A total of around 50 line km was flown (inclusive of tie-lines). Approximately 20 infill gravity stations were also collected within ERL 148 and this data is also yet to be received. All of these surveys will be reported in the coming year's annual report.en_US
